WHAT YOU CAN EXPECT FROM THIS JOB
Now that you know what you can expect from us, it’s time to unpack what you can expect from this job.
As a Graduate Planner working at DotActiv, your dedicated learning focus will include:
- DotActiv Mastery Levels - mastering our full software product suite;
- Advanced Merchandising and Display Techniques;
- Introduction to Retail;
- Introduction to Category Management;
- Account Development;
- Job shadowing and on-the-job learning;
- Leadership short courses; and
- Business Process training.
After your training, you should be able to do the following:
- Create strategic assortment plans;
- Design data-driven floor space plans;
- Plan and build data-driven shelf plans;
- Conduct floor and space plan analytical reviews;
- Build ranging reports and category analytical reviews;
- Maximise customer and category performance by considering category strategies and plans, product
- financial performance, shopper psychology and aesthetic appeal; and
- Support, advise and guide retail customers where required.
- You’ll have access to DotActiv’s all-in-one category management software to complete all of the above.
Requirements
WHAT WE EXPECT FROM YOU?
- In our quest to find the right candidate to fill the critical position of category planner, we need to ensure they
- have the required skills to perform the job.
- We have broken the required skills into three parts: Education Skills, Knowledge and Computer Skills; and Soft
Skills.
Skills And Requirements
- A Consumer Science, Commerce degree or similar degree at a recognised and accredited university;
- A good understanding of English (You must be able to speak, read and write at a business proficiency level); and
- While not required, experience in a retail or service environment is advantageous.
- A valid driver’s licence and vehicle are required as you may need to travel to meet with clients.
- A working laptop using Microsoft Windows. DotActiv software operates on the Microsoft Windows platform.
- We do offer a laptop allowance included in your CTC.
